intelligent' Guardian It’s autumn in Maine, and the town lawyer Bob
Burgess has become enmeshed in an unfolding murder investigation,
defending a lonely, isolated man accused of killing his mother. He
has also fallen into a deep and abiding friendship with the
acclaimed writer, Lucy Barton, who lives nearby in a house next to
the sea. Together, Lucy and Bob talk about their lives, their hopes
and regrets, and what might have been.Lucy, meanwhile, befriends
one of Crosby’s longest inhabitants, Olive Kitteridge, now living
in a retirement community on the edge of town. They spend
afternoons together in Olive’s apartment, telling each other
stories. Stories about people they have known – “unrecorded lives,”
Olive calls them – reanimating them, and, in the process, imbuing
their lives with meaning.Brimming with empathy and pathos, TELL ME
EVERYTHING is Elizabeth Strout operating at the height of her
powers, illuminating the ways in which our relationships keep us
afloat. As Lucy says, “Love comes in so many different forms, but
it is always love.”'A superbly gifted storyteller and a craftswoman
